On the early morning of July 9, 2013, 22-year-old Black African American male Terrance D. Williams stood outside the 16 Park apartment complex on the near north side of Indianapolis, Indiana. It was shortly after 1:30 a.m., and Williams was in the company of his 24-year-old cousin in the 1600 block of Park Avenue.
